How To Fix /SPE/INSPRES008 - No record exists in database for RMA &1 delivery &2 and HU &3


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SPE/INSPRES -

  • Message number: 008

  • Message text: No record exists in database for RMA &1 delivery &2 and HU &3

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SPE/INSPRES008 - No record exists in database for RMA &1 delivery &2 and HU &3 ?

    The SAP error message /SPE/INSPRES008 indicates that there is no record in the database for a specific Return Material Authorization (RMA) related to a delivery and Handling Unit (HU). This error typically arises in the context of logistics and inventory management, particularly when dealing with returns or inspections.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Data: The specified RMA, delivery, or Handling Unit may not exist in the database. This could be due to:

      • The RMA was not created or was deleted.
      • The delivery document does not correspond to the RMA.
      • The Handling Unit (HU) is not associated with the delivery or RMA.
    2. Incorrect Input: The input parameters (RMA number, delivery number, HU number) may have been entered incorrectly, leading to a mismatch.

    3. Data Synchronization Issues: If the system is integrated with other systems (like a warehouse management system), there may be synchronization issues causing the data to be out of sync.

    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or access the RMA, delivery, or HU records.

    Solution:

    1. Verify Input Data: Check the RMA number, delivery number, and HU number for accuracy. Ensure that they are correctly entered and correspond to existing records.

    2. Check RMA and Delivery Status:

      • Use transaction codes like VA03 (Display Sales Order) or VL03N (Display Outbound Delivery) to verify if the RMA and delivery exist.
      • Ensure that the RMA is in a status that allows it to be processed.
    3. Inspect Handling Unit:

      • Use transaction HU02 (Display Handling Unit) to check if the HU exists and is correctly linked to the delivery.
    4. Data Consistency Check: If you suspect data synchronization issues, perform a consistency check or consult with your IT department to ensure that all systems are synchronized.

    5.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ary permissions to access the RMA, delivery, and HU records.

    6. Consult Documentation: Review SAP documentation or consult with your SAP support team for any specific configurations or settings that may affect the processing of RMAs.
